Output 38aef1c84398adb482bde666e88baa48d0270555eb660e446589394f75b8e994:3

value
31566282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8f4d821f5e208d6756adc8d7af66e2d5e70211 OP_EQUAL
address
3Qu1E7t9kupZsTqmaq1n7nKAn4kHYrcCDm
transaction
38aef1c84398adb482bde666e88baa48d0270555eb660e446589394f75b8e994
spent
true